Understanding the Role of Ball Milling in Mining

Ball milling is a fundamental size reduction process used in mineral beneficiation, cement production, and ore processing. It works by rotating a cylindrical chamber filled with grinding media, which crushes and grinds raw materials into fine particles.

A Wet Ball Mill is commonly used when materials need to be processed in a slurry form. The addition of water improves grinding efficiency, reduces dust, and helps in transporting fine particles through the system. On the other hand, a Conical Ball Mill features a tapered design that enhances grinding efficiency by promoting gradual size reduction and improved material flow.

Both the Wet Ball Mill and Conical Ball Mill are essential in different stages of mineral processing, and choosing the right one depends heavily on the nature of the ore and the desired output.

Wet Ball Mill: Efficiency in Slurry-Based Grinding

The Wet Ball Mill is widely used in mining operations where materials are processed with water to form a slurry. This method is especially effective for ores that require fine grinding and improved mineral liberation.

One of the key advantages of a Wet Ball Mill is its ability to reduce heat generation during grinding. This prevents material degradation and improves overall efficiency. In large-scale mining operations, Wet Ball Mill systems are often preferred because they allow continuous processing with stable output quality.

Conical Ball Mill: Precision Grinding with Enhanced Efficiency

The Conical Ball Mill is designed with a unique tapered shape that allows for more controlled grinding. This design helps in gradually reducing particle size, which improves efficiency and reduces energy consumption.

Unlike traditional cylindrical mills, the Conical Ball Mill ensures better material distribution and reduced over-grinding. This makes it particularly useful in applications where product uniformity is critical.
